Sunflower Lyrics
Six acres of concrete wasteland,one sunflower standing tall,
I didn't know your name, I didn't know your fame,
I just liked you that's all.
I cannot buy you diamond rings, for christ sake I can barely sing,
I feel like a teenager in danger of doing that falling for thing.
I didn't mean for this happen, but the greatest things happen by accident,
Like the apple on Isaac's head.
We sat for hours, you measured your thumb against mine,
Electricity shooting down my spine .
We sat for hours, we waited till the sun went down,
Alighted the night bus, nowhere near this town.
Six acres of concrete wasteland,one sunflower standing tall,
I didn't know your name, I didn't know your fame,
I just proper liked you that's all.
We talked histories and pasts, I let you read the second draft,
Converging through the afternoon.
We sat for hours, you measured your thumb against mine,
Electricity shooting down my spine.
We sat for hours, you weathered my monologue,
A burning beacon, burning through the fog.
Standing out from the crowd that's just the way you are,
To look that good should not be allowed, our local movie star.
The girls all call in envy, the guys all call in envy
la de da de da de da de do.
We sat for hours, you measured your thumb against mine,
Electricity shooting down my spine.
We sat for hours, we waited till the sun went down,
Alighted the night bus nowhere near this town.
Six acres of concrete wasteland,one sunflower standing tall,
I didn't know your name, I didn't know your fame,
I just liked you that's all.
I didn't know your name, I didn't know your fame,
I just liked you that's all.
